logo

Output ea177240ecc521f3db550a8ffbc861530aaa84ef653d16de0c4551eb4f24faa4:0

value
21156
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 522bf661944a5b5a36b3c847a2ca34e1e311fe04 OP_EQUALVERIFY OP_CHECKSIG
address
18VV5HzmP1mi9TqRFPdm9QLpE64E5e1M8C
transaction
ea177240ecc521f3db550a8ffbc861530aaa84ef653d16de0c4551eb4f24faa4